Blockchain technology has been revolutionizing various industries, and the payroll processing sector is no exception. Understanding key terms and vocabulary related to blockchain in payroll processing is crucial for professionals aiming to leverage this technology effectively. In this module, we will delve into essential concepts to provide a comprehensive understanding of blockchain technology in the context of payroll processing.
1. Blockchain: Blockchain is a decentralized, distributed ledger technology that securely records transactions across a network of computers. Each block in the chain contains a list of transactions, and once recorded, these blocks cannot be altered without consensus from the network participants. This makes blockchain highly secure and transparent, ideal for payroll processing where data integrity is paramount.
2. Cryptocurrency: Cryptocurrency is a digital or virtual currency that uses cryptography for security. It operates independently of a central authority, making it decentralized and secure. In the context of payroll processing, cryptocurrencies can be used for payments, allowing for faster and more cost-effective transactions compared to traditional banking methods.
3. Smart Contracts: Smart contracts are self-executing contracts with the terms of the agreement between parties directly written into lines of code. These contracts automatically execute and enforce themselves when predefined conditions are met. In payroll processing, smart contracts can automate payment processes, ensuring timely and accurate disbursements to employees.
4. Distributed Ledger: A distributed ledger is a database that is consensually shared and synchronized across multiple sites, institutions, or geographies. Blockchain technology utilizes a distributed ledger to record and track payroll transactions securely and transparently. This eliminates the need for intermediaries and reduces the risk of fraud or errors in payroll processing.
5. Immutable: Immutable refers to the characteristic of blockchain technology where once data is recorded in a block, it cannot be altered or deleted. This ensures the integrity and permanence of payroll records, providing a tamper-proof audit trail for all transactions. Immutable records enhance trust and transparency in the payroll process.
6. Decentralized: Decentralized means that there is no central authority or intermediary controlling the blockchain network. Instead, transactions are validated by network participants through a consensus mechanism. Decentralization eliminates single points of failure and enhances security in payroll processing by distributing control among network nodes.
7. Consensus Mechanism: Consensus mechanism is the process by which network participants agree on the validity of transactions and the order in which they are added to the blockchain. Popular consensus mechanisms include Proof of Work (PoW) and Proof of Stake (PoS). A robust consensus mechanism is essential for maintaining the security and integrity of payroll data in blockchain networks.
8. Permissioned Blockchain: A permissioned blockchain restricts access to authorized participants only, ensuring that sensitive payroll data is shared securely among trusted parties. Permissioned blockchains are suitable for payroll processing where confidentiality and data privacy are critical considerations. Access controls can be tailored to specific roles within the payroll ecosystem.
9. Tokenization: Tokenization involves converting real-world assets or rights into digital tokens on a blockchain. In the context of payroll processing, tokenization can represent employee salaries, benefits, or incentives in a secure and traceable format. Tokens can be transferred between parties instantaneously, streamlining payroll transactions and enhancing liquidity.
10. Wallet: A wallet is a digital tool that allows users to store, send, and receive cryptocurrencies or tokens securely. Payroll processors can use wallets to manage employee payments, automate payroll disbursements, and track transaction histories. Wallets provide a user-friendly interface for interacting with blockchain assets in the payroll ecosystem.
11. Audit Trail: An audit trail is a chronological record of activities or transactions that provides a transparent history of changes. Blockchain technology maintains an immutable audit trail of all payroll transactions, enabling auditors to verify the accuracy and integrity of data. Audit trails enhance compliance and accountability in payroll processing.
12. Interoperability: Interoperability refers to the ability of different blockchain networks or systems to communicate and exchange data seamlessly. Payroll processors may need to integrate multiple blockchain platforms or applications to streamline payroll operations. Interoperability standards ensure compatibility and smooth data flow across disparate systems.
13. Scalability: Scalability is the capacity of a blockchain network to handle increasing transaction volumes without compromising performance. As payroll processing involves numerous transactions, scalability is crucial for maintaining efficiency and responsiveness. Blockchain solutions must be scalable to support the growing demands of payroll operations.
14. Data Privacy: Data privacy concerns the protection of sensitive information from unauthorized access or disclosure. Blockchain technology enhances data privacy in payroll processing by encrypting sensitive data and restricting access through cryptographic keys. Employees' personal information and payment details are safeguarded, ensuring compliance with privacy regulations.
15. Compliance: Compliance refers to adhering to legal regulations, industry standards, and internal policies governing payroll processing. Blockchain technology can automate compliance checks, verify identities, and enforce regulatory requirements in real-time. By ensuring compliance, payroll processors mitigate risks and build trust with employees and regulatory authorities.
16. Traceability: Traceability is the ability to track and verify the origin and movement of assets or data throughout the supply chain. In payroll processing, blockchain enables traceability of payroll funds from the employer to the employee, ensuring transparency and accountability. Employees can trace their payments back to the source, enhancing trust in the payroll process.
17. Fraud Prevention: Blockchain technology provides robust security features that help prevent fraud in payroll processing. By creating a tamper-proof ledger and implementing multi-factor authentication, blockchain reduces the risk of unauthorized access or manipulations. Fraudulent activities can be detected and mitigated proactively, safeguarding payroll funds and employee data.
18. Token Economy: A token economy is an ecosystem where digital tokens are used as a medium of exchange for goods, services, or assets. In payroll processing, a token economy can incentivize employees through tokenized rewards or bonuses. Employees can redeem tokens for various benefits or privileges, fostering engagement and loyalty within the workforce.
19. Cross-Border Payments: Blockchain technology facilitates cross-border payments by eliminating intermediaries and reducing transaction costs. Payroll processors can use blockchain for international payroll transfers, enabling fast and secure transactions across borders. Cryptocurrencies and stablecoins can be used to bypass traditional banking systems, accelerating payment settlements.
20. Smart Payroll: Smart payroll refers to the integration of blockchain technology and smart contracts to automate payroll processes. Smart payroll systems can calculate wages, deduct taxes, and disburse payments automatically based on predefined conditions. By streamlining payroll operations, smart payroll enhances efficiency, accuracy, and compliance in organizations.
